Hall Construction Services, B General Building Contractor in Orcutt, CA
Hall Construction Services operating as a sole owner holds an active California contractor license (CSLB #1046904), valid through Nov 30, 2026. First issued in 2018, the license has been on the CSLB roster for 8 years. It carries a single CSLB classification: B — General Building Contractor. Records show an active surety bond on file with Western Surety Company and an exempt workers' compensation status (no employees on payroll). The business is based in Orcutt, in Santa Barbara County, California.
